Having dry skin can be challenging, especially in a Nordic climate where the air can be quite harsh. I’ve discovered that a minimalist skincare routine not only makes my daily regimen easier but also helps my skin feel more balanced and hydrated.
One key aspect of my routine is prioritizing hydration. I start with a gentle, hydrating cleanser, followed by a lightweight serum infused with hyaluronic acid. This combination keeps my skin moisturized without that heavy or greasy feeling. I also enjoy using a nourishing oil to lock in moisture and achieve that coveted dewy glow.
When it comes to exfoliation, I believe in the ‘less is more’ approach. Using a mild exfoliant once a week has been effective in keeping my skin smooth while preserving its natural oils. I prefer products that feature natural ingredients, which align perfectly with my minimalist approach.
